Calories in Granola

Granola is a breakfast food and snack food consisting of rolled oats, nuts, honey or other sweeteners, and sometimes puffed rice, baked until crisp. It's often rich in calories, healthy fats, and fiber, making it an energy-dense option.

Granola
453
calories per 1 cup (111g)
Protein
10.2g
Carbs
80.4g
Fat
12.2g
Fiber
7.7g
Sugar
28.7g
Sodium205mg
Nutrition data sourced from FatSecret. Values may vary based on preparation and serving size.

Health Benefits

1

Rich in Fiber: Supports digestive health and can help maintain satiety.

2

Source of Healthy Fats: Often contains nuts and seeds, providing mon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ats beneficial for heart health.

3

Provides Energy: Its combination of complex carbohydrates and fats offers sustained energy release.

Nutrition Tips

  • Portion control is key due to its high calorie density.
  • Pair granola with plain yogurt or fresh fruit to add protein and vitamins without excessive sugar.
  • Look for varieties with lower added sugar and higher fiber content.
  • Consider making your own granola to control ingredients and sugar levels.
  • Use granola as a topping for smoothies or salads for a crunchy texture and energy boost, rather than a standalone large serving.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is granola a healthy breakfast option?+

Granola can be a healthy option due to its fiber and healthy fats, but many commercial varieties are high in added sugar and calories. It's important to check the nutrition label and choose wisely.

How much granola should I eat in a serving?+

A typical serving size for granola is usually 1/4 to 1/2 cup (about 30-60 grams), depending on the specific product and your dietary needs. Due to its calorie density, portion control is crucial.

Does granola help with weight loss?+

While granola is filling and can be part of a balanced diet, its high calorie density means it can contribute to weight gain if consumed in large portions. For weight loss, focus on low-sugar varieties and strict portion control.
